The future Rome, rising to regenerate the nation, has now long been a dominant idea in my mind, and inspired me with hope and energy.
Said by
Giuseppe Garibaldi

Editor's note · Context

Expressing his long-held vision for Rome's role in the unification and renewal of Italy.
